The GI tract is a finely balanced environment where roughly 500 different strains of bacteria compete for space and nutrients. When there is a healthy balance (eubiosis), few symptoms exist. However, this natural microflora balance can become disrupted by certain medications, excessive alcohol consumption, or poor dietary intake, leading to an overabundance of potentially harmful organisms (dysbiosis).
BioShield® technology is Ortho Molecular Products' integrated probiotic protection system designed to support organism stability, survivability, and targeted delivery. Because probiotics are living microorganisms, they must be protected from environmental stressors such as moisture, heat, light, and oxygen throughout manufacturing, storage, and distribution. BioShield® technology uses a specialized cryoprotection and freeze-drying process to help preserve probiotic organisms in a stable, dormant state until they encounter moisture within the GI tract. Paired with advanced delayed-release encapsulation, this approach helps shield the organisms from harsh upper-GI conditions and supports more precise delivery to the intestinal tract, where the probiotics can provide their intended benefit.

Lactobacillus acidophilus (La-14)
Lactobacillus acidophilus is a beneficial bacteria strain normally found in the intestinal tract and mouth, as well as in acidophilus-type yogurt. L. acidophilus ferments various carbohydrates to produce lactic acid, which increases the absorption and bioavailability of minerals. This includes calcium, copper, magnesium and manganese. The production of lactic acid also promotes health by creating an inhospitable environment for invading organisms. L. acidophilus has been shown to protect intestinal cells by competing for adhesion space in the gut against harmful bacteria. The strain in Ortho Biotic® has been specifically chosen because of its strong adherence and survival attributes in the GI tract. It has been demonstrated in vitro to tolerate exposure to gastric acid and bile salts, and has the ability to withstand certain medications.
Lactobacillus paracasei (Lpc-37)
Lactobacillus paracasei has shown to protect against the harmful effects of unwanted bacteria. L. paracasei colonizes the intestinal tract by reinforcing defense mechanisms that support an immune response. It does this by supporting T-helper cell production and secreting secretory IgA (sIgA), an antibody critical for supporting intestinal immunity. L. paracasei is highly resistant to acids and enzymes in the GI tract and is known to produce short-chain fatty acids for healthy intestinal barrier function.

Lactobacillus plantarum (Lp-115)
Lactobacillus plantarum is a beneficial bacteria strain commonly found in fermented foods, including sauerkraut, pickles, brined olives, and sourdough. It has been associated with systemic health benefits such as promoting inflammatory balance and normal metabolic health. L. plantarum has been found to compete against unwanted bacteria due to the production of bacteriocins (lethal proteins). Evidence supports that L. plantarum helps boost the immune response by stimulating Th1-mediated immunity.
Lactobacillus rhamnosus (GG)
Lactobacillus rhamnosus has been proven to have remarkable survivability in the acid and bile environments in the GI tract. L. rhamnosus is particularly useful because of its ability to adhere to cells, enhance microflora balance, and inhibit adherence of unwanted agents. L. rhamnosus was also found to positively affect inflammatory and immune gene signaling of over 1,700 genes when administered in high doses.
Saccharomyces boulardii
Saccharomyces boulardii is a probiotic yeast that was first isolated from the skin of the tropical fruits lychee and mangosteen in 1923 by French scientist Henri Boulard, following the observation that mangosteen consumption controlled occasional diarrhea in natives of Southeast Asia. S. boulardii plays a role in supporting immune defense by increasing levels of sIgA, creating a first line of defense that helps bind and clear harmful bacteria.
